Very thorough "historical" information
~ Written on Dec 28, 2009. out of users found this review helpful.

This book has very through, detailed, accurate content as pertains to the future "historical" time line and every proper noun that has ever come up in any series it covers (names of people, places, context, etc.). I was hoping for more technical details, like the difference between a class 4 and class 9 probe, floor plans of star ships, etc. Maybe that info isn't really available anywhere.

All in all a great reference for any Trek enthusiast. Let me repeat: VERY THOROUGH.
